1/2" x 5-1/2" Hot Dip Galvanized Steel Hex Head Lag Screws HLSHS-516 Diameter: 1/2" Length: 5-1/2" Material: Steel Finish: Hot Dip Galvanized Head Style: Hex (3/4" Wrench) Point Type: Gimlet Thread Length: Partial Type: Hex Lag Screw A lag screw is similar to a wood screw, but generally is much larger with a hexagonal head. Lag bolts are designed for securely fastening heavy timbers to one another, or to fasten wood to masonry or concrete.
